What is a Funds Flow Statement?
A Funds Flow Statement is a financial statement that provides a summary of the inflow (sources) and outflow (uses) of funds in a business over a specific period. It helps in understanding the changes in the financial position of a business between two balance sheet dates.
Uses of Funds Flow Statement
Financial Analysis and Planning
The Funds Flow Statement is a vital tool for financial analysis and planning. It provides a detailed view of the sources and applications of funds, enabling businesses to plan their financial strategies effectively.
Understanding the Financial Health of a Business
By analyzing the inflow and outflow of funds, the Funds Flow Statement provides insights into the financial health of a business. It helps in identifying any potential financial issues that may need attention.
Decision Making
The Funds Flow Statement is a valuable tool for decision-making. It provides the necessary information for making informed decisions about investments, financing, and operations.
Performance Evaluation
The Funds Flow Statement can be used to evaluate the performance of a business. By comparing the actual flow of funds with the planned or budgeted flow, businesses can assess their financial performance.
